Source here (http://www.telegraph.co.uk/news/main.jhtml;sessionid=LE01RWUDBFEHZQFIQMGSM5OAVCBQWJVC?xml=/news/2004/11/06/wbig06.xml&sSheet=/portal/2004/11/06/ixportal.html) Fat Americans are eating into the US air industry's bottom line, forcing planes to consume ever more fuel to transport their bulk.
The average weight of Americans rose by 10lb during the 1990s and what a new survey called this "additional adiposity" caused airlines to use a further 350 million gallons of fuel in 2000, at a cost of £149 million. This is hitting the environment with an extra 3.8 million tons of carbon dioxide being released into the atmosphere.
Bankrupt United Airlines, America's second biggest air travel company, recently announced that it would spend £650 million more than expected on fuel this year because of rising oil prices.
To reduce the weight carried by their planes, airlines have dumped metal cutlery and large magazines and want to use lighter materials in seating. But passenger size is more difficult to control.
To howls of outrage from the country's "fat acceptance" lobby, Southwest Airlines has begun asking larger travellers to purchase a second seat. <:lol - beet>
"The obesity epidemic has unexpected consequences beyond direct health effects," said Dr Deron Burton of the US Centre for Disease Control and Prevention, which published the findings. "Our goal was to highlight one area that had not been looked at before."
America's eating habits have been blamed for a lower than expected rise in life expectancy and dearer health insurance but never before for contributing to the woes of a whole sector of the economy.
A commuter plane crash that killed 21 people in North Carolina last year has been blamed on the passengers' greater than average weight.

I haven't read any other replies yet, but I have been following this crash investigation (much the same way as AAL587) and so far the focus is on the control rigging for the elevator.
They were improperly rigged and did not give the pilots the ability to use full deflection of that control surface. There was a bit of an aft CG (Center of Gravity) but it was within the airplane's load limits. To see if this was something that would be considered 'easily noticable' the investigation took some very experienced pilots in the airplane and had them do a walk-around of the airplane which had been rigged (intentionally) the same way. I don't remember the numbers, but you could count on one hand the number of pilots that thought there was a problem with the way it was set up.
There have been a lot of issues (I think it's laughable that the average American with clothing, especially in winter, is 170 lbs) regarding weight of passengers. Even if overweight due to the passengers, overload percentage (in terms of pounds, how many % overweight it is) was small enough that if the rigging wasn't faulty, nothing would have happened.
